Tucked on a quiet cul-de-sac just off Burton Road, this neatly presented two-bedroom period terrace blends original character with practical modern finishes. The living room and dining room retain period touches, while the kitchen-diner provides a sensible everyday hub with space for a table.
Both double bedrooms benefit from re-fitted en-suite bathrooms, a rare convenience in a compact terrace, and the property is offered freehold with no onward chain — appealing for first-time buyers seeking a ready-to-move-in home in West Didsbury. A private rear courtyard gives outdoor space and gated access to the rear passageway, although the garden is small and low maintenance rather than a full lawn.
Buyers should note the house is a compact, small-to-average footprint typical of early 20th-century terraces. Walls are solid brick (insulation status assumed absent), so there may be scope and cost to improve thermal efficiency. The property has double glazing (unknown install date) and mains gas central heating; council tax is moderate.
